What is Diebold Nixdorf's non-controlling interests?
Diebold Nixdorf (DBD) reported non-controlling interests of $3.3M in Q1 2026.
How has Diebold Nixdorf's non-controlling interests changed year-over-year?
Diebold Nixdorf's non-controlling interests decreased by 52.9% year-over-year, from $7M to $3.3M.
What is the long-term trend for Diebold Nixdorf's non-controlling interests?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Diebold Nixdorf's non-controlling interests has grown at a 1.3%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from -$4.6M to $4.9M.
What does non-controlling interests mean?
Equity attributable to minority shareholders in subsidiaries not fully owned by the parent — their proportional claim on subsidiary net assets.
